1. Acoustic Environment
The acoustic environment directly impacts the quality of an audiobook recording. Untreated spaces introduce unwanted reverberation and background noise, degrading clarity. This results in a product that is less appealing to listeners. A controlled environment, conversely, allows for a cleaner, more focused recording. The relationship is causal: poor acoustics inherently lead to poor audio quality. The absence of sound treatment means reflections of the voice reach the microphone at slightly different times, creating a muddy or echoey sound. This is a fundamental element when considering the processes involved in the production of professional-sounding spoken-word recordings.
Real-world examples demonstrate this principle clearly. Recording in a closet lined with blankets reduces reflections, yielding a noticeably improved sound compared to recording in a bare room. Professional studios invest heavily in acoustic panels, bass traps, and diffusers to optimize sound characteristics. The practical significance is that investing in acoustic treatment, even on a small scale, drastically improves the final result. Failure to do so often necessitates extensive and costly post-production efforts to mitigate sonic imperfections. Even the best microphones and recording equipment cannot fully compensate for poor acoustic conditions.

2. Microphone Selection
Microphone selection is a critical component of the recording process. The choice of microphone fundamentally influences the captured sound’s clarity, warmth, and overall character. A suitable microphone accurately reproduces the nuances of the narrator’s voice, contributing significantly to the audiobook’s professional quality.
-
Microphone Type: Condenser vs. Dynamic
Condenser microphones offer higher sensitivity and a wider frequency response, capturing more detail and nuance. They are typically preferred for studio recording due to their ability to reproduce subtle vocal inflections. Dynamic microphones, conversely, are more robust and less sensitive, making them suitable for environments with higher background noise. While less commonly used for audiobook narration, they can be effective in less-than-ideal recording spaces. The selection depends on the acoustic environment and desired sonic characteristics.
-
Polar Pattern: Cardioid, Omnidirectional, Bidirectional
A microphone’s polar pattern dictates its sensitivity to sound from different directions. Cardioid microphones primarily pick up sound from the front, rejecting sound from the rear and sides. This is generally preferred for audiobook recording as it minimizes room noise and reflections. Omnidirectional microphones pick up sound equally from all directions, making them unsuitable for most recording scenarios unless used in a highly controlled environment. Bidirectional microphones pick up sound from the front and rear while rejecting sound from the sides, and they have limited applications in audiobook production.
-
Frequency Response
A microphone’s frequency response indicates its sensitivity to different frequencies. A flat frequency response provides a more accurate reproduction of the source audio. However, some microphones exhibit specific frequency curves that may complement certain vocal characteristics. Understanding the frequency response chart can help in selecting a microphone that aligns with the narrator’s voice and the desired sound profile of the audiobook.
-
Self-Noise and Signal-to-Noise Ratio
Self-noise refers to the inherent noise generated by the microphone’s internal circuitry. A lower self-noise rating is crucial for capturing clean audio, particularly in quieter recording environments. The signal-to-noise ratio (SNR) quantifies the difference between the desired audio signal and the background noise. A higher SNR indicates a cleaner recording with less audible noise. Selecting a microphone with low self-noise and a high SNR is essential for achieving a professional-sounding audiobook.

3. Recording Software
Recording software, also known as a Digital Audio Workstation (DAW), is an indispensable tool in the production of audiobooks. It provides the interface and functionalities necessary for recording, editing, and processing spoken word content, thereby shaping the final product’s quality and overall listener experience.
-
Core Recording Functions
The primary function of recording software is to capture audio input from a microphone. This involves setting input levels, monitoring audio signals to prevent clipping or distortion, and initiating and terminating recording sessions. For example, a narrator using Adobe Audition can establish appropriate gain settings to ensure their voice is recorded at an optimal level, avoiding overmodulation which introduces unwanted artifacts. Proper use of these functions is vital for a clean, professional recording.
-
Editing and Noise Reduction
DAWs offer a suite of editing tools that allow for the removal of errors, pauses, and unwanted sounds such as breaths or mouth clicks. Noise reduction features, such as spectral editing and noise gating, can eliminate background hum or hiss that may be present in the recording. For instance, software like Audacity can be used to identify and remove ambient noise picked up during recording, resulting in a cleaner, more focused audio track. These capabilities are crucial for maintaining listener engagement and ensuring a polished final product.
-
Audio Processing and Enhancement
Recording software enables the application of various audio effects to enhance the narrator’s voice. Equalization (EQ) can adjust the tonal balance of the recording, compression can reduce dynamic range and increase perceived loudness, and other effects such as reverb or chorus can be used sparingly for creative purposes. A real-world application involves using EQ to emphasize the clarity of a narrator’s voice, or compression to maintain a consistent volume level throughout the recording. Judicious application of these tools enhances clarity and listenability.
-
File Management and Exporting
DAWs facilitate the organization and management of audio files, including raw recordings, edited tracks, and processed audio. They also provide options for exporting the final product in various audio formats, such as MP3 or WAV, with specific bitrates and sample rates suitable for distribution on platforms like Audible or iTunes. Proper file management and exporting settings ensure compatibility and optimal audio quality across different playback devices. The ability to encode the final recording according to industry standards is paramount for commercial release.

6. Mastering Quality
Mastering, in the context of audiobook production, represents the final critical step in transforming an edited audio file into a commercially viable product. It ensures optimal playback compatibility across diverse listening devices and platforms, contributing significantly to the overall auditory experience. Neglecting mastering can result in inconsistent volume levels, undesirable sonic artifacts, and diminished audience engagement, ultimately impacting market success.
-
Loudness Normalization
Loudness normalization ensures that the audiobook conforms to industry standards for perceived loudness, preventing listeners from having to constantly adjust the volume. Platforms such as Audible employ specific loudness targets, and mastering ensures adherence to these targets. Failure to normalize loudness can result in an audiobook being rejected by distribution platforms or, more critically, leading to an unsatisfactory listening experience characterized by volume fluctuations. Mastering thus integrates standardization for audio distribution, a crucial aspect of producing a commercially viable audiobook.
-
Equalization and Tone Shaping
Equalization during mastering refines the overall tonal balance of the recording, addressing any remaining frequency imbalances that might detract from clarity or listenability. It entails subtle adjustments to frequencies in specific sections of the recording, to improve the audio’s balance. This involves fine-tuning frequency levels and ranges, a process which needs a professional ear for optimum quality, thus having proper equalization helps in the making of quality audiobooks.
-
Compression and Dynamic Range Control
Compression techniques, judiciously applied during mastering, further control the dynamic range of the audio, ensuring a consistent and pleasing listening experience. While compression may have been applied during the earlier editing phase, mastering provides an opportunity for additional refinement. In practice, this ensures consistent volume throughout the performance, allowing for smoother listening.
-
Noise Reduction and Artifact Removal
The mastering stage provides a final opportunity to address any remaining instances of unwanted noise or sonic artifacts. While comprehensive noise reduction should ideally occur during the editing process, subtle noise reduction techniques can be used during mastering to further refine the audio. This involves removing excess background or white noise, which can drastically improve the overall listenability of an audiobook.

7. Distribution Strategy
Distribution strategy, in the context of audiobook production, is inextricably linked to the decisions made throughout the recording process. The chosen distribution channels directly influence technical specifications, marketing approaches, and ultimately, the commercial viability of the audiobook. A poorly considered distribution strategy can negate the benefits of even the highest-quality recording.
-
Platform-Specific Requirements
Different distribution platforms, such as Audible, iTunes, and Spotify, impose distinct technical requirements regarding audio file format, bitrate, and loudness normalization. For example, Audible mandates specific loudness levels (e.g., -20 dB LUFS) for all submitted audiobooks. Failure to adhere to these specifications can result in rejection or compromised audio quality. Understanding these platform-specific requirements informs decisions made during recording, editing, and mastering.

Frequently Asked Questions
The following addresses common inquiries regarding the technical and artistic aspects of creating professional-grade spoken-word recordings. These questions aim to provide clarity and guidance for individuals involved in the creation of a marketable audiobook.
Question 1: What constitutes a suitable acoustic environment for voice recording?
An acceptable recording space minimizes unwanted reverberation and external noise. This typically involves using sound-absorbing materials, such as acoustic panels or heavy blankets, to reduce reflections and create a drier, more controlled sound. Small rooms or closets, when properly treated, can often serve as effective recording environments.
Question 2: Is specialized equipment required, or can a standard computer microphone suffice?
While a basic computer microphone may capture sound, professional-grade results necessitate dedicated equipment. This typically includes a condenser microphone with a cardioid polar pattern, a pop filter, and a shock mount. These components collectively minimize noise and capture a more accurate representation of the narrator’s voice.
Question 3: What recording software is recommended for audiobook production?
Several digital audio workstations (DAWs) are suitable for audiobook production. Popular options include Adobe Audition, Audacity (a free option), and Logic Pro X. These programs offer the necessary tools for recording, editing, noise reduction, and mastering audio files.
Question 4: What performance techniques are crucial for effective narration?
Effective narration requires clear articulation, consistent pacing, and varied vocal inflection. A narrator should strive to convey emotion and meaning through subtle changes in tone and delivery. Practice and vocal exercises are essential for developing these skills.
Question 5: What are the essential steps in the audio editing process?
Audio editing involves removing extraneous noises, correcting errors, and adjusting the timing and pacing of the recording. Noise reduction techniques are often employed to eliminate background hum or hiss. The goal is to create a clean, consistent, and engaging listening experience.
Question 6: How does mastering contribute to the overall quality of an audiobook?
Mastering is the final step in audio production. It involves optimizing the audio file for playback across different devices and platforms. This includes loudness normalization, equalization, and compression. Mastering ensures that the audiobook meets industry standards for audio quality and loudness.
